How they compare

Republic of Moldova currently reports 1.21 GPIA against 1.07 GPIA in UNICEF: East Asia and the Pacific Programme Countries, a difference of 0.14 GPIA.

That makes Republic of Moldova's figure about 1.1 times UNICEF: East Asia and the Pacific Programme Countries's.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 12 shared years of data; in 2012 it was UNICEF: East Asia and the Pacific Programme Countries ahead.

Republic of Moldova ranks 18th and UNICEF: East Asia and the Pacific Programme Countries ranks 15th of 96 countries.

Across the 2 decades both report, Republic of Moldova averaged higher in 1 and UNICEF: East Asia and the Pacific Programme Countries in 1.
